How to Snuggle with Your Partner

Snuggling may seem straightforward, but there are techniques to maximize the experience:

  1. Choose the Right Setting: Find a cozy spot, be it the couch, bed, or even a picnic blanket.
  2. Set the Mood: Create a calming atmosphere with soft lighting, music, or comforting scents.
  3. Start Slowly: Begin with gentle touches or light caresses to ease into the cuddling experience.
  4. Be Mindful of Body Language: Pay attention to your partner's cues. Adjust your position or pressure accordingly.
  5. Engage in Conversation: Share thoughts or stories while cuddling to deepen the emotional connection.

FAQs

1. How often should couples cuddle?

There’s no set rule, but regular cuddling can enhance intimacy and connection. Aim for a few times a week at minimum.

2. What are some good cuddling positions?

Popular positions include spooning, the cradle, and side-by-side cuddling. Experiment to find what feels best for both partners.

3. Can cuddling help reduce stress?

Yes, cuddling releases oxytocin, which can lower stress and promote feelings of happiness.

4. Is cuddling beneficial for mental health?

Absolutely! Physical affection can lower anxiety levels and improve overall mental well-being.

5. What if my partner doesn’t like to cuddle?

Communicate openly with your partner about your needs. Explore other forms of physical affection that might be more comfortable for them.

6. How can I initiate cuddling?

Start by creating a cozy environment and gently inviting your partner to cuddle, perhaps while watching a movie or relaxing together.

7. Can cuddling improve relationship satisfaction?

Yes, couples who engage in regular cuddling often report higher relationship satisfaction and improved communication.

8. What are some creative cuddling ideas?

Try cuddling while reading a book together, watching a series, or stargazing outside.

9. Is it normal for couples to cuddle less over time?

Yes, it can happen, but it's important to maintain physical affection for a healthy relationship. Make an effort to cuddle regularly.

10. How can I make cuddling more enjoyable?

Create a warm atmosphere, communicate openly about comfort levels, and explore different cuddling styles.
